How they compare
Senegal currently reports 5.00 million against 4.84 million in Zambia, a difference of 154,240.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 21 shared years of data; in 1991 it was Zambia ahead.
Senegal ranks 23rd and Zambia ranks 24th of 50 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Senegal averaged higher in 1 and Zambia in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Senegal | Zambia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 3.08 million | 3.28 million | 204,468 | Zambia |
| 2000s | 4.10 million | 4.17 million | 70,474 | Zambia |
| 2010s | 4.92 million | 4.74 million | 181,125 | Senegal |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
